I Have My Late Husband’s Name Tattooed on My Chest — My Fiancé Insists I Remove It

After losing my husband and 4-year-old son in a tragic boating accident,

I spent three years trying to rebuild my life.

To honor their memory, I got a tattoo on my chest — their names in cursive,

surrounded by two small hearts. It was my way of keeping them close.

When I met Julius, my fiancé,

I opened up about my past and the pain I carried.

He was understanding and kind,

and for the first time in years, I felt ready to love again.

But recently, Julius asked me to do something that broke my heart — he wanted me to remove the tattoo.

He said it made him uncomfortable, especially during intimate moments,

and that it was time to “move on” before we got married. I told him I couldn’t do that; the tattoo wasn’t about clinging to the past,

but about remembering those I lost. Since then, he’s grown distant, barely speaking to me.

When I confided in my mom, I expected comfort, but she surprised me by agreeing with Julius.

She said removing it might help me “start fresh.

” I felt torn between love for the family I lost and the life I was trying to build.

Was keeping the tattoo really a sign I hadn’t moved on, or simply proof that grief and love can coexist?

Online, people were overwhelmingly on my side

. They reminded me that moving forward doesn’t mean forgetting — it means carrying the past with strength and grace.

One comment struck me deeply: “You never stop being a mom.”

That truth settled my heart. I realized that anyone who truly loves me should accept all the parts of my story — even the ones written in ink.
